Output 1f4bc544dcd809ec26feb4bbf1efeba22e64ffac335e20c90d2541a31aa10ffd:3

value
952951
script pubkey
OP_0 OP_PUSHBYTES_20 16b6b65397ec70053951ca59732812cf64602d89
address
bc1qz6mtv5uha3cq2w23efvhx2qjeajxqtvfs28ql4
transaction
1f4bc544dcd809ec26feb4bbf1efeba22e64ffac335e20c90d2541a31aa10ffd
confirmations
53005
spent
true